3. Day-by-Day Plan

Day 1

The Seat of Knowledge

☀️ Morning
Drive to Nalanda. Explore the excavated ruins of the ancient university.
🌤️ Afternoon
Visit the Nalanda Museum and Xuanzang Memorial Hall.
🌙 Evening
Drive to Rajgir (15km). Check in and relax. Visit Venu Vana park.
🛏️ Stay: Rajgir🚗 Notes: Patna to Nalanda: 90km (2.5 hrs).
Day 2

Peaks of Peace

☀️ Morning
Take the Ropeway to Vishwa Shanti Stupa. Visit Gridhakuta (Vulture's Peak).
🌤️ Afternoon
Visit the Hot Springs (optional) or Cyclopean Wall. Lunch in Rajgir.
🌙 Evening
Drive back to Patna or catch train from Rajgir.
🛏️ Stay: Depart🚗 Notes: Rajgir local sightseeing by Tanga or Cab.

5. Travel & Stay Notes

📍 Suggested Base Cities

Patna or Rajgir (Start) → Patna or Rajgir (End)

🏨 Where to Stay

Rajgir has better hotels than Nalanda. Look for resorts near the Virayatan area or government guest houses like BSTDC Tathagat Vihar.

💰 Budget Guidance

₹3,000 - ₹5,000 per person (includes private cab)

🚕 Transport

Private Cab recommended

6. Cultural & Practical Tips

🍽️ Food to Try

  • 🥘 Khaja (Nalanda specialty)
  • 🥘 Local sweets in Rajgir

🗣️ Language & Etiquette

Hindi is standard. Guides at Nalanda speak English.

  • 💡 Hire a guide at Nalanda (approx ₹200-300) for context.

7. Common Questions

Is the ropeway safe?

Yes, it is a single-seater chair car. Safe, but avoid if you have severe vertigo.

How much walking is involved?

Nalanda ruins cover a large area. Expect to walk 2-3km. Rajgir involves some climbing if not using ropeway.

Can we do this in one day?

It is rushing it. You will miss the sunset vibes of Rajgir. 2 days is ideal.
